If you are debating whether to get the Blade 15 Advanced or Blade 17, look no further and get the Blade 17. I had both and decided to return the Blade 15 Advanced because the Blade 17 had better thermals and performance. The Blade 17 definitely ran cooler (the case isn't so hot to touch when playing games as compared to the Blade 15 Advanced) and quieter. The only downside is that the Blade 17 is heavier.
I consistently get 120HZ and the screen is amazing. Just make sure to update all your drivers! Honestly, the best gaming and Windows laptop that I have ever owned.

The Razerbook 17 is quite amazing. I was not expectint this great of performance from a gaming laptop that doesn't look like a gaming laptop. It is heavy like most other 17inch laptops, but a lot lighter than the Dell G series.
The screen is awesome and the colors are great. I was able to run most games at 120 fps on ultra or high. I did have some trouble with the initial windows 11 set up as it caused some frame drops. After updating all the drivers and the synapse application (you have to use) it worked great.
The only problem i really have is that the corners are sharp. Its a very minor complain since the last 2 laptops i owned were the same.
I plan to add another ssd and update this review in a few months to see if it still holds up. Overall no buyers remorse!

I have not used much the laptop yet so this is about one negative aspect of it that I didn't like at all. I knew by pictures seen before I bought it that the keyboard was not a full complete keyboard but, after buying it and having it, I realized its keyboard layout is kind of horrible. Keys feels great, they looks awesome with the colors, etc., but it is missing too many keys: up and down arrow keys are half size; there is no Page Down, Page Up, Home and End keys, there is no Windows key to the right of the space bar. I really don't understand why a 17" laptop, with so much "real estate" for a full keyboard, has such a down sized layout. Those two speakers at right and left of the keyboard could be placed somewhere else! The only positive side of having such a stripped down keyboard is that space bar and letter keys are more centered. Full keyboards demand that even the touch pad has sometimes to be placed to the left to match the position of the space bar. Anyway, for the price I paid, for the size of this laptop, I would prefer it had a full keyboard with Num Pad or at least a full keyboard w/o the Num Pad but all the rest, including full-size up and down arrow keys after all, this is also a gaming laptop and up and down arrow keys are essential in some games.
